Tian Di, female, Han ethnic group, member of Communist Party of China, Master, Associate Professor, Master Supervisor, director of Institute of Folk Music Studies,member of Pipa Society of China Musicians’ Association, member of China Nationalities Orchestra Society, specially invited Pipa player of Gansu Song and Dance Theater.

Career and education:

1997-2001: Bachelor of Pipa performance at the School of Music, Northwest Normal University, after Hou Xinru.

2005-2008: Master of Theory of Traditional Chinese Music at the School of Music, Northwest Normal University, after Hou Xinru.

Teaching at the School of Art of Lanzhou University since 2001.

Training and further education:
March, 2013: Central Conservatory of Music, after professor Zhang Qiang, famous modern Pipa performer, Department of Folk Music.

Education and research field:

Research field: Pipa performance, theory of traditional Chinese music

Courses offered: Pipa performance, folk music quartet
